Flight Risk is a DieselPunk Western Actual Play Dramedy, using the Fistful of Darkness/Scum & Villain rulesets, set in the original Western setting of Vaporum . Join Flight Risk, an eccentric group of mercenaries, as they are thrust into the dark and violent world of organized crime. As agents of an enigmatic Count, they traverse the Outer Rim in an attempt to not only survive but to realize their destiny without losing their souls. Flight Risk is hosted by DeWayne Feenstra with players Velvet, Nemoy, and Kyle.

A very enjoyable new show
Flight Risk is set in the Old Republic era of Star Wars, and that allows the GM to tell some engaging stories without having to worry too much about getting tangled up in the present lore. The show follows two campaigns at the moment on alternating weeks, linked by the notorious Dowutin crime lord Baron Yendall.
The show is off to a very strong start and I look forward to seeing where it goes next!
